YOUR NEW ROLE
Using best practice change management methodologies the role ensures the organisation has the change management framework and tools to support the effective delivery of projects and change initiatives. As part of the Enterprise Risk & Program Management Office this role will partner with project sponsors and managers to provide expert change management advice in the planning and delivery of key organisation wide projects at the Opera House.
The position plays a lead role in key change initiatives and partners with project personnel to establish clear and comprehensive change plans monitor progress and facilitate cross functional collaboration to ensure the successful achievement of project deliverables business outcomes and organisation and cultural renewal. The role seeks to identify operational and business process impacts associated with major projects and change initiatives to ensure change plans support the realisation of agreed project benefits.

ARE YOU THE ONE
We are looking for someone who has:
Bachelors level minimum tertiary qualification (Business Change Management Program/Project Management Technology) or equivalent experience.
Sound knowledge of best practice change and project management principles and experience in applying these.
Experience in managing the development and implementation of change initiatives designed to improve organisational effectiveness.
Ability to build effective business partnering relationships including an ability to analyse and evaluate and develop options and solutions.
Well-developed interpersonal facilitation influencing negotiation networking and relationship management skills
Strong communication skills including report writing and presentation skills/experience.
Experience knowledge and understanding of the Performing Arts Industry or experience in a sector or industry with similar complexities.
